Advertisement

Java工具类:RabbitMQ工具类RabbitmqUtil

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:RabbitmqUtil 是一个用于简化 Java 项目中 RabbitMQ 操作的工具类库,提供发送、接收消息及连接管理等功能。 1. Java工具类RabbitmqUtil是我封装好的可以直接使用。 2. 常用的方法都在这个工具类里面。 3. 只需调整初始化配置参数即可。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• JavaRabbitMQRabbitmqUtil
    优质
    简介:RabbitmqUtil 是一个用于简化 Java 项目中 RabbitMQ 操作的工具类库,提供发送、接收消息及连接管理等功能。 1. Java工具类RabbitmqUtil是我封装好的可以直接使用。 2. 常用的方法都在这个工具类里面。 3. 只需调整初始化配置参数即可。
  • RabbitMQ与测试(完整版)
    优质
    本资源提供了一个完整的RabbitMQ工具类及对应的单元测试代码。通过简洁高效的API设计帮助开发者快速集成消息队列功能,并确保代码质量。 RabbitMQClientUtil 是一个用于 MQ 测试的工具类,它封装了 fanout、direct 和 topic 三种交换模式,并包括发送数据和接收数据的功能。Test1 和 Test2 是使用 Maven 管理的测试类,在 pom.xml 文件中引入如下代码: ```xml com.rabbitmq amqp-client 3.6.5 ``` 配置文件 rabbitmq.properties 根据需要自行放置,放置完毕后,请自己修改 util 中的文件地址。
  • SpringBoot中使用RabbitMQ
    优质
    本工具类为Spring Boot项目提供便捷的RabbitMQ消息队列操作功能,简化了配置与发送接收消息的代码实现。 在使用Spring Boot与RabbitMQ的工具类时,该类包含了一些较为原始的方法以及一套基于Spring Boot框架封装的方法。通常情况下有两个方法可供选择:一个是直接使用的原生方法;另一个则是结合了Spring Boot特性的自定义实现。一般推荐优先选用后者,因为这些由前辈们精心设计并经过实际检验的方法更为成熟可靠。相比之下,自行编写的方法虽然可以根据具体需求进行定制化开发,但在功能完善性和稳定性方面可能略逊一筹,可以作为参考学习原理之用。
  • RabbitMQ的封装与实现
    优质
    简介:本文详细介绍了如何对RabbitMQ进行工具类封装及其实现方式,方便开发者高效利用该消息队列中间件。 封装了RabbitMQ的订阅者线程和发布者线程,并且有一个用于初始化工厂连接的工具类。此外还有一个安卓使用的示例代码。
  • Java SHA256Util
    优质
    简介:SHA256Util是用于实现Java环境中数据安全哈希处理的工具类,主要功能为利用SHA-256算法对输入字符串进行加密处理,确保数据传输和存储过程中的安全性。 使用Java原生的摘要算法实现SHA256加密的方法如下: 首先需要导入相关的类: ```java import java.security.MessageDigest; ``` 接着创建MessageDigest对象并初始化为SHA-256: ```java try { MessageDigest digest = MessageDigest.getInstance(SHA-256); } catch (Exception e) { // 异常处理代码 } ``` 然后将需要加密的数据转换成字节数组,并通过digest.update()方法更新摘要对象,这里假设数据为一个字符串: ```java String input = 待加密的原始文本; byte[] bytesOfMessage = input.getBytes(UTF-8); digest.update(bytesOfMessage); ``` 最后获取SHA256编码后的结果并转换为十六进制表示形式输出: ```java byte byteData[] = digest.digest(); StringBuilder hexString = new StringBuilder(); for (int i=0;i
  • Java RedisUtil
    优质
    RedisUtil工具类是为Java应用程序设计的一个实用工具库,它封装了与Redis数据库交互的基本操作,简化数据存取流程,提高开发效率。 该工具类包含了redis String、map、set、list四种数据类型的常用操作方法。
  • Java Toolkit
    优质
    简介:Toolkit是Java提供的一个抽象类,它为图形设备提供一组通用的操作,如图像获取、鼠标器和键盘查询等,广泛应用于GUI应用程序开发中。 常用的处理封装包括 JsonResult、PageBean、exception 处理以及 excel 操作工具类 FtpHelper 和 HttpHelper。此外还有加密解密相关工具如 AESHelper、DESHelper 和 RSAHelper,中文处理工具 ChineseUtil 以及反射操作 ReflectionUtil 等实用功能模块。集合和转换相关的 CollectionHelper 和 ConvertUtil 提供了便利的数据结构支持;日期时间管理 DateUtil 及文件操作 FileUtil 助力高效开发。图像处理 ImageUtil 和 JSON 处理 JsonUtil 是前后端交互的重要工具,配置加载 PropertiesLoader 与属性验证 ValidatorUtil 则有助于项目的灵活扩展和维护。压缩相关 ZipUtil 提供了便捷的文件打包解包功能。
  • EasyExcel.java
    优质
    简介:该文件提供了使用Apache EasyExcel进行数据导出和导入的Java工具类实现,简化了Excel操作,提高开发效率。 POI的EasyExcel工具类用于在Java程序中导入Excel表格。
  • JavaBase64Utils
    优质
    Base64Utils是用于Java编程语言的一个工具类,它提供了将二进制数据编码为ASCII字符格式以及反向解码的功能。此工具极大地方便了开发者在需要传输或存储非文本信息时的编码需求。 Base64Utils是一个Java工具类。